Enter Crafted Spaces, a Hyderabad-based design firm spearheading architecture and interior design projects, curated with style by Mitali Aharam.

Crafted Spaces recently worked its magic on The Fleur Home, a stunning 4,000 square-feet villa designed for a family of three. This corner abode, situated in a serene gated community in Hyderabad, underwent a complete transformation. Surrounded by lush greenery, the home exudes a perfect blend of minimalism and warmth, enriched with Indian aesthetics.

Upon stepping into The Fleur Home, your senses are immediately captivated by exquisite details that grace the surroundings. Two classical Chettinad wooden pillars, standing on a granite base, elegantly define the formal and dining spaces. Delicate black and white hand-painted artwork adorns the dining and entrance living walls, subtly introducing a touch of floral art.

The open-plan living area is seamlessly tied together by white rafters in the ceiling and white wainscoting on the walls. A refreshing pop of mint green infuses the kitchen cabinets, harmonizing with the green undertones of the marble flooring. Textured glazed backsplash tiles add depth to the space.

Retaining existing door frames, doors, and windows, each element was painted in a pristine white hue, complemented by flowing white linen curtains. A French door was thoughtfully incorporated into the dining area, providing access to the inviting lawn, while floor-length windows enhance the sense of openness.

On the ground floor, the guest bedroom boasts wardrobes featuring white embroidered fabric between glass panels and a beautiful two-poster bed. Ascending to the first floor, you’ll be greeted by abundant natural light in the common area. Two bedrooms and a sunroom, accessed through a French door, await your exploration. A balcony was cleverly fashioned on an unused slab projection, creating an enchanting space to unwind.

The sunroom on this level steals the spotlight, featuring a warm wooden sloped ceiling and a distressed white wooden day bed—a perfect retreat for coffee and reading. The master bedroom showcases a high wooden sloped ceiling, painted white, adorned with a subtly striking black and white wallpaper. The room is harmonized by white paneled wainscoting and a complementing white shiplap ceiling.

The daughter’s bedroom is a dreamy haven, featuring a floral hand-painted mural on the bed headboard and soft pastels with gold hand-painted birds on the study table wall and ceiling. The Fleur Home is truly a masterpiece of thoughtful design and artistic finesse.
